What is Fake Crab?
Fake crab, or imitation crab, is a seafood product made primarily from surimi, which is a paste created from finely minced fish, usually Alaskan pollock. The surimi is blended with various additives to enhance flavor, texture, and color, making it resemble real crab meat. The production process of fake crab typically involves the following steps:
- **Fishing:** Pollock is caught and processed into surimi.
- **Processing:** The surimi is mixed with starch, egg whites, and flavorings.
- **Shaping:** The mixture is shaped into crab-like pieces, often resembling crab legs.
- **Freezing:** The final product is frozen for preservation and distribution.
Nutritional Value of Fake Crab
The nutritional value of fake crab can vary based on the brand and specific product. However, a typical serving (about 3 ounces) of imitation crab meat contains:
- Calories: 81
- Protein: 15 grams
- Fat: 0.5 grams
- Carbohydrates: 6 grams
- Sodium: 744 mg
While imitation crab is low in fat and calories, it is essential to be aware of its sodium content, which can be quite high due to added preservatives and flavorings.
Health Benefits of Fake Crab
There are several health benefits associated with consuming fake crab as part of a balanced diet:
1. Low in Calories
Imitation crab is a low-calorie food, making it an excellent option for those looking to manage their weight without sacrificing flavor in their meals.
2. High in Protein
Fake crab is a great source of protein, which is essential for muscle repair, immune function, and overall health. Each serving provides a significant amount of protein without the high fat content found in other protein sources.
3. Versatile Ingredient
Fake crab can be used in various dishes, from salads and sandwiches to pasta and sushi, making it easy to incorporate into different meal plans.
4. Omega-3 Fatty Acids
While the amount of omega-3 fatty acids in imitation crab is not as high as in real crab, it still provides some level of these beneficial fats, which are essential for heart health.
Potential Risks of Fake Crab
Despite its health benefits, there are some potential risks to consider when consuming fake crab:
1. High Sodium Content
The sodium content in imitation crab is often high due to added preservatives, which can contribute to hypertension and other cardiovascular issues if consumed excessively.
2. Allergies
Some individuals may have allergies to the fish used in imitation crab or other ingredients, such as gluten, which may be present in certain brands. Always check labels for allergens.
3. Lack of Nutrients
While fake crab is a source of protein, it lacks some of the essential vitamins and minerals found in real crab, such as vitamin B12 and zinc.

Fake Crab vs. Real Crab
When comparing fake crab to real crab, here are some key differences:
- **Nutritional Content:** Real crab is richer in vitamins and minerals, while fake crab has lower fat and calories.
- **Cost:** Imitation crab is significantly cheaper than real crab, making it a more budget-friendly option.
- **Flavor:** Many seafood lovers prefer the taste of real crab, although imitation crab can still be delicious in various dishes.
Popular Recipes with Fake Crab
Here are a few popular recipes that showcase the versatility of fake crab:
- **Imitation Crab Salad:** Mix imitation crab with diced vegetables, mayonnaise, and seasonings for a quick and easy salad.
- **Crab Rangoon:** Fill wonton wrappers with a mixture of imitation crab, cream cheese, and green onions, then fry until golden brown.
- **Crab Alfredo:** Toss cooked pasta with imitation crab, Alfredo sauce, and steamed broccoli for a creamy, satisfying meal.
